Meganewton [MN]


Meganewton is a large unit of force in the International System of Units (SI).



  • 1 meganewton (MN) equals 10610^{6} newtons (1,000,000 newtons).



  • It is commonly used to measure very large forces in engineering, such as the thrust of rocket engines or loads on large structures.

Meganewtons are useful for quantifying forces much greater than those in everyday life but smaller than giganewtons and above.


Kilogram-Force [kgf]


Kilogram-force (kgf) is a unit of force based on the force exerted by one kilogram of mass under standard gravity.



  • It is defined as the force exerted by a mass of 1 kilogram under Earth's gravitational acceleration (9.80665 m/sยฒ).



  • Mathematically:

  • Although not an SI unit, kilogram-force is commonly used in engineering and industries to express force more intuitively related to mass.



Example: A force of 10 kgf corresponds to approximately 98.07 newtons.
